Wired: A Ralph Nader [Domain Name] Plan That ‘Sucks’

“Critics, malcontents, and disgruntled employees would be
able to register domain names like microsoft.sucks and
mcdonalds.sucks, according to a proposal from two organizations
that Nader heads.”

“On Wednesday, they sent a letter to ICANN asking permission to
set up a service that would provide 10 new top-level domains,
including .union, .sucks, .ecology, and .complaints.”

“The idea, according to Jamie Love of the Consumer Project on
Technology, is to create non-corporate discussion and organizing
areas ‘to enable citizens to improve civil society.’ “
